Discharge Pipe Temperature Control

Outline
The discharge pipe temperature is used as the internal temperature of the compressor. If the
discharge pipe temperature rises above a certain level, the upper limit of frequency is set to
keep the discharge pipe temperature from rising further.

When the temperature reaches the stop zone, the compressor stops.
The upper limit of frequency decreases.
The upper limit of frequency is kept.
The upper limit of frequency increases.
The upper limit of frequency is canceled.
